I have been looking for a stable trading system for a long time and wanted to share my BBMA template/configuration file here. I think most of you have heard of the BBMA strategy. It was developed by Oma Ally and in my opinion this strategy contains the most important pillars in the form of indicators required for a successful trading system.
Basically, the simplest and most effective form of trading with the BBMA strategy is to trade in the direction of the main trend after the correction on the higher time frame has ended.
I open this post for traders, especially those who are still looking for a good system with great potential.
Developing a general understanding of BBMA may seem complicated at first, but it gets better over time. The advantages of BBMA are many and I would like to list a few here…
- Trend following system, able to identify momentum, re-entry of different TFs in a trend, volume of losses in a trend (beginning of a larger correction or reversal). With BBMA, you can identify trends, corrections, trends, and reversal cycles.
- Trade higher TF through multi-TF analysis (W1 to M5)
- Trade from higher TF after correction ends
- Trade in the trend direction of higher TF
- Time your entries on smaller TFs to get a very good risk to reward ratio. (SL is available on M5-M15, and TP is available on H1, H4, D1, and W1)
- Understand the end of a correction to resume the larger trend.
